WebJul 12, 2016 · Sounds That Trigger Noise Phobia in Dogs. Fireworks, gunshots and vacuum cleaners are common causes of noise phobia, according to Dr. Borns-Weil. “Dogs may also become phobic of fire alarms and even cooking because they associate it with accidental triggering of the alarm,” Dr. Borns-Weil adds. There are also less common fear triggers, … WebDec 19, 2016 · A phobia is an intense and persistent fear that occurs for as long the phobic dog is confronted by, or even anticipating, the triggering cue. WebDec 17, 2024 · What Is the Fear of Dogs? Symptoms Diagnosis Causes Treatment Cynophobia, the phobia (irrational fear) of dogs, is a type of anxiety disorder. 1 Cynophobia is more than being afraid of dogs or not wanting to be around dogs. This type of fear interferes with your daily activities.
